Check Digit Verification of cas no

The CAS Registry Mumber 1431693-88-7 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,4,3,1,6,9 and 3 respectively; the second part has 2 digits, 8 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 1431693-88:
(9*1)+(8*4)+(7*3)+(6*1)+(5*6)+(4*9)+(3*3)+(2*8)+(1*8)=167
167 % 10 = 7
So 1431693-88-7 is a valid CAS Registry Number.
